Schoenorchis seidenfadenii
 
I purchased this plant as Schoenorchis fragrans, but was told that it was not that species, but seidenfadenii and after doing some research, agree. The lip and striping on the petals seem to be characteristic of that species. I've found any species in this genus to be poorly identified. I have four of them in my collection all from different sources and none of them was correctly id'd.
